Successful simplified genomic profiling of cytology specimens using Aspyre Clinical Test for Lung (Tissue). [PDF]
Cytology specimens from patients with non–small cell lung cancer were tested using Aspyre Clinical Test for Lung (Tissue) and the results compared to an orthogonal assay. 84/85 samples passed quality control, and all detected variants matched expected results including SNVs from KRAS, SNVs and indels from EGFR, MET exon 14 skipping and gene fusions in ...

Knudsen effects in liquid helium. [PDF]
Knudsen effects, the seemingly anomalous behaviour seen in a rarified gas when the molecular mean free path becomes comparable with the size of the container, were first investigated systematically just after the turn of the century.
